What is the Level 6 Diploma in Information Technology?
The Level 6 Diploma in Information Technology is an advanced qualification aimed at individuals seeking to deepen their understanding of IT concepts and applications. It is equivalent to the final year of a bachelor’s degree and is recognized globally for its rigorous curriculum and industry relevance.
Key Features of the Course:
- Focus on advanced IT topics such as software development, cybersecurity, and data analytics.
- Practical, hands-on learning to prepare students for real-world challenges.
- Flexible study options, including online and part-time modes.
- Globally recognized qualification, enhancing employability.
Why Pursue a Level 6 Diploma in Information Technology?
The IT sector is one of the fastest-growing industries globally, with a projected growth rate of 13% from 2020 to 2030 (U.S. Bureau of Labor Statistics). Here are some compelling reasons to consider this diploma:
Reason
Details
High Demand for IT Professionals
Over 1.5 million IT job openings are expected annually in the U.S. alone.
Lucrative Salaries
IT professionals earn an average salary of $88,240 per year, significantly higher than the national average.
Career Advancement
The diploma opens doors to senior roles such as IT Manager, Systems Analyst, and Cybersecurity Specialist.
